Rosalyn Landor can be counted on for a cool, elegant, accomplished delivery, and she does not disappoint in this deliciously creepy mystery from the master. Ismay Sealand has reason to believe that her little sister, Heather, drowned their stepfather in his bath when they were children. Now grown, the sisters share a flat. They have been bound by their shared (if undiscussed) past, but now that they both have grown-up love lives and are planning separate futures, the unspoken keeps bobbing up. Even the abridgment is here masterfully done, which is a lot for this abridgment-averse reviewer to grant. As often with Rendell, the minor characters, Ismay's snobbish upper-crust boyfriend, Heather's horrible future mother-in-law, are the most fun. Landor makes the most of them.
